Why Power Wheels 6 Volt Battery Is Necessary

I’ve found that a Power Wheels 6 volt battery is necessary because it gives the ride-on toy the right amount of power to run safely and smoothly. When I use the correct battery, the car starts properly, moves at a manageable speed, and stays reliable during playtime. It helps the toy perform the way it was designed to, which makes the experience more enjoyable for me and safer for kids.

My biggest reason for choosing a 6 volt battery is that it matches the vehicle’s original setup. Using the correct voltage helps prevent damage to the motor, wiring, and other parts. I’ve learned that the wrong battery can cause performance issues or shorten the life of the toy, so the 6 volt option is important for protecting the investment.

I also like that a Power Wheels 6 volt battery is easier to handle for younger children. It provides enough fun without making the ride too fast or hard to control. For me, that balance between excitement and safety is exactly why this battery is necessary.

My Buying Guides on Power Wheels 6 Volt Battery

Why I Pay Attention to the Battery First

When I look for a Power Wheels 6 volt battery, the battery is the first thing I focus on because it directly affects how long the ride lasts and how well the toy performs. In my experience, a good battery makes a big difference in power, charging time, and overall fun. If the battery is weak or not the right fit, the ride can feel slow and frustrating.

Check the Compatibility Before Buying

The first thing I do is make sure the battery matches the exact Power Wheels model. Not every 6 volt battery works with every ride-on toy, so I always check the product details carefully. I look at the size, connector type, and voltage to avoid buying the wrong one. A compatible battery saves me time and prevents unnecessary returns.

Look at Battery Life and Runtime

For me, runtime is one of the most important features. I want a battery that gives my child enough playtime without needing constant recharging. I usually compare how long the battery lasts on a full charge and how long it takes to recharge. A longer runtime means more fun and fewer interruptions.

Choose a Battery with Good Charging Performance

I always pay attention to charging performance because it affects convenience. Some batteries charge faster and hold power better than others. In my experience, a battery that charges efficiently is easier to manage, especially when the toy is used often. I also make sure to follow the charging instructions carefully so the battery lasts longer.

Consider Safety Features

Safety matters a lot to me when buying any battery for a child’s ride-on toy. I look for batteries that are sealed, durable, and designed specifically for children’s products. I also prefer batteries from trusted brands that meet safety standards. A reliable battery gives me peace of mind while my child is riding.

Check the Build Quality and Durability

I want a battery that can handle regular use without wearing out too quickly. Good build quality usually means better performance over time. I look for strong construction and dependable materials because I know ride-on toys can be used often and sometimes roughly. A durable battery is usually worth the investment.

Think About Replacement and Maintenance

When I buy a Power Wheels 6 volt battery, I also think about how easy it is to maintain. I prefer batteries that are simple to install, remove, and recharge. I also make sure to store the battery properly when it’s not in use. Basic care helps extend battery life and keeps it working better for longer.

Compare Price and Value

I don’t always choose the cheapest battery because low price doesn’t always mean good value. Instead, I compare price with runtime, durability, brand reputation, and warranty. In my experience, paying a little more for a better battery often saves money later. I try to find the best balance between cost and quality.

Read Reviews Before I Decide

Before I make a final choice, I always read customer reviews. Reviews help me understand how the battery performs in real use, not just on paper. I pay attention to comments about charging, battery life, fit, and reliability. Honest feedback from other buyers helps me make a smarter decision.

Final Thoughts

When I buy a Power Wheels 6 volt battery, I focus on compatibility, runtime, safety, durability, and value. My goal is to choose a battery that keeps the ride fun, safe, and dependable. Taking a little time to compare options helps me feel confident that I’m making the right purchase.
